Maintain Ideal Conditions
Excess humidity puts firearms at risk. Place a dehumidifier rod or silica gel pack inside your safe to reduce rust and corrosion. Keep your guns clean and lightly oiled, and maintain separate ammunition storage for additional safety.

2. Protecting Important Documents Why a Fireproof Safe Is Essential
Fires can ruin vital paperwork fast. Passports, birth certificates, insurance records, and deeds are exposed unless kept in a fire-rated safe. When protecting documents in Wendell, look for a safe with no less than a 60-minute fire rating. Liberty Safes are independently tested to withstand extreme heat, maintaining paper under 350°F — the temperature at which paper chars.
Organize and Protect
Even the most fire-resistant safe benefits from good organization. Employ water-resistant folders or sleeves to safeguard against moisture or smoke damage. Add digital backups (USB drives or portable HDDs) in the same safe, or in a secondary safe designed for media protection.
Keep Access Simple but Secure
If other household members may need to retrieve documents during an emergency, an electronic lock permits easy code access. Liberty offers UL-listed electronic locks that are both easy to use and highly secure.
Location Matters
Install your safe in an area less exposed to extreme temperatures, like an interior wall or ground level. Avoid placing it near heating vents, windows, or attics where fire intensity tends to be higher.

4. Fire and Theft Protection: Why Liberty Safes Stand Out
Fire Protection You Can Trust
Every Liberty Safe is built with layers of fireboard insulation and Palusol™ expanding door seals. When exposed to heat, these seals expand up to seven times their normal size to block flames and smoke.
Liberty’s testing confirms safes keep safe internal temperatures. From 30-minute protection in smaller models to as much as 2.5+ hours in top-tier safes, Liberty offers peace of mind across all budgets and needs.
Security You Can Trust
Liberty Safes use heavy-gauge American steel and precision-engineered locking mechanisms that withstand prying, drilling, and impact. With deep-engaging locking bars and anti-punch hardplate protecting the lock, Liberty has earned its reputation for world-class security.
